About the Role

We are seeking an experienced Project Manager to lead the construction of complex water and wastewater treatment facilities.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record of successfully delivering large-scale infrastructure projects on time, within budget, and to the highest safety and quality standards.

This is a leadership role requiring strong technical expertise, financial acumen, and the ability to manage diverse teams and stakeholders in a high-paced environment.
  • Lead and manage all phases of water/wastewater plant construction projects, from planning to closeout.
  • Oversee project budgets, schedules, and resources to ensure successful delivery.
  • Coordinate with clients, engineers, subcontractors, and regulatory agencies.
  • Ensure strict adherence to safety, quality, and environmental standards.
  • Negotiate contracts, change orders, and manage risk thro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Provide mentorship, leadership, and guidance to project teams.
  • Drive stakeholder communication, reporting, and client satisfaction.
  • 10+ years of experience managing water and/or wastewater plant construction projects.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Construction Management, Engineering, or related field.
  • Strong knowledge of water/wastewater process systems, civil/structural works, and mechanical/electrical installations.
  • Proven ability to manage projects exceeding $15M in value.
  • Exceptional leadership, negotiation, and communication skills.
  • Experience with alternative delivery methods (CMAR, Design-Build, etc.).
  • Proficiency with project management tools (Primavera P6, MS Project, Procore, etc.).
  • PMP or PE license preferred but not required.
